Transaction 16603d434b5402aeb533df134c80010316e3c7a2cf6cfb9ede158e8592796c26

1 Input
2 Outputs
  • 16603d434b5402aeb533df134c80010316e3c7a2cf6cfb9ede158e8592796c26:0
  • value  15000000
    address  3F64wf15XAk4SQMvTmisxHwebBwqJ5vhZs
  • 16603d434b5402aeb533df134c80010316e3c7a2cf6cfb9ede158e8592796c26:1
  • value  34966266
    address  38aHMbCgBWbfRepSn64qQNsk4hEycr3bcL